Output 85bc9c0ae6521d421e4d93baf8338600c0420bfab670d96bc40d4e18f4662f6e:0

value
3154490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b0aad74652e849ab0ac4ff1558df7745a623960 OP_EQUAL
address
349zxcVvVxJy6ncj5vSg6D72dCWwhqWYqx
transaction
85bc9c0ae6521d421e4d93baf8338600c0420bfab670d96bc40d4e18f4662f6e
spent
true